What just happened
The Rights Issue Committee of Annvrridhhi Ventures Limited approved the second and final call on its outstanding partly paid-up rights equity shares. The company has fixed July 14, 2026, as the record date to identify eligible shareholders.
Why this matters
This action aims to raise ₹11.85 crore (₹1,184.87 lakh) by collecting ₹4.00 per share from 2,96,21,647 outstanding partly paid-up rights equity shares. This is the final step in realizing the capital from the rights issue originally allotted in December 2025.
The backstory
The partly paid-up rights equity shares were originally allotted on December 17, 2025, based on a Letter of Offer dated November 1, 2025. This capital call is a scheduled follow-up to that allotment.
What changes now
Shareholders holding these specific partly paid-up shares must be prepared to pay the final call amount of ₹4.00 per share by the deadline associated with the July 14, 2026 record date. Failure to comply could lead to penalties, including potential forfeiture of shares.
Risks to watch
Shareholders who do not have the liquidity to meet the ₹4.00 per share call amount face the risk of losing their investment in these partly paid-up shares.
